Experience one of Québec's most spectacular natural attractions. Standing 83 metres (272 feet) high—30 metres taller than Niagara Falls—Montmorency Falls offers spectacular views from accessible walking paths. The cable car is not included, as our visit focuses on the scenic viewpoints and walking trails that showcase the falls up close.
